Report: Roxana School District spent $13,521 per student in 2019-20

Spending per pupil at Roxana Community Unit School District 1 was up 11.6 percent from five years ago, according to the Education Daily Wire analysis of the latest Illinois schools report card district finances.

The Illinois State Board of Education 2019-20 report card showed the Madison County school district spent $12,118 per pupil in 2015-16. It spent $13,521 in 2019-20.

The district's enrollment fell from 1,978 to 1,815 students over the same period.

Roxana's spending in 2019-20 was 6.7 percent lower than the state average of $14,492.
